Legal Requirements & Penalties in WV
West Virginia law requires workers' compensation coverage for most businesses. Failure to comply can result in fines and penalties. The system provides benefits for work-related injuries regardless of fault.

Industry Risk Factors & Class Codes
Premiums are based on classification codes assigned to job roles. High-risk industries like forestry pay more than low-risk ones like office work. Keeping accurate records helps reduce costs.

Frequently Asked Questions
What does workers compensation insurance cover?
It covers medical expenses, lost wages, and rehabilitation for employees injured at work, as well as liability protection for employers.
Is workers compensation required in Hendricks?
Yes, just like the rest of WV, employers in Hendricks must provide coverage or face penalties.
